County teams prepare to open district play

Published

on

 

JdMoore carries the ball for Forestburg during the Trinidad game on Sept. 29. (Courtesy photo)

Bowie and Nocona High School football had built-in bye weeks this past Friday, giving them two weeks to prepare for the district season opener this Friday night.
For the smaller schools, Gold-Burg earned its first win of the 2017 season, while Forestburg continued its winning streak with a victory over Savoy and Saint Jo fell to Throckmorton.
Now, four of the five will play district openers this Friday.
Boyd at Bowie
The Bowie Jackrabbits are set to open the 2017 district season at home against the Boyd Yel-lowjackets with kick-off at 7:30 p.m. as they come out of the off-season with a 1-4 record.
“The first district game is always really exciting,” said Bowie Head Football Coach and Athletic Director Dylan Stark. “We played a really tough non-district to prepare for district, and this is when it counts. We are definitely excited to get started.”
